Step-by-step explanation:

The question requires calculating the proportions of two solutions to create a final mixture with a specific concentration of alcohol. To solve this, we must apply the concept of mixtures in mathematics, using algebraic methods and units of volume measurement.

Without the concentration percentages of Pretone and Pleak, further calculations cannot be performed. However, the question might be hinting at a simple algebraic problem where essentially one would set up an equation based on volume and concentration ratios to find out the volumes required. Assuming Pretone and Pleak have different alcohol percentages, one way to set up the equation is:

If we let Pretone have an alcohol percentage P and Pleak have an alcohol percentage L, and the final desired percentage is 15%, for the mixture totaling 20 liters, we could use the equation: P x + L (20 - x) = 20 * 0.15, where x is the liters of Pretone.
